Galnewa Ranaviru Village Marks Anniversary


The 10th anniversary of founding of Galnewa Ranaviru Village was marked with a series of commemorative events on Sunday (30).

Of them, a cricket match played between Vijayabahu Infantry Regiment (VIR) Headquarters team and Galnewa Ranaviru Village team, drew the attention of all the villagers who flocked to the general play ground at Galnewa Ranaviru village.

The arrangement, organized on a proposal made by Major General R.V Samarathunga, Colonel of the Vijayabahu Infantry Regiment was witnessed by senior officers, including Commanding Officer at VIR Headquarters.
Ranaviru village cricket team won the match and received a trophy from the Chief Guest on the occasion. VIR ‘Ransara’ music band provided entertainment to the occasion at the end of the match.
